Needless to say, less is more for her. Still, pictures will be taken almost continuously that day. So I opted for Make Up For Ever HD Foundation as a base, buffed in with a Real Techniques Stippling Brush. As I said in my foundations post, this one provides medium to full coverage without looking like you put on a mask. No need for blusher or highlighter, but I did use L'OrĂ©al's Glam Bronze Duo Powder to warm up her face just a tad.

Since her dress is a bright red, I wanted to keep the eyes classy and matte - think Audrey Hepburn in Breakfast At Tiffany's minus the winged liner. I primed the eyes with Urban Decay's Primer Potion and put a tiny bit of the YSL Touche Eclat all over the lid to provide some subtle shimmer. On with a wash of W.O.S. from the Naked Basics Palette and Naked 2 into the crease with a Real Techniques Shading and Deluxe Crease brush. Next a bit of the Maybelline Master Drama Kohl pencil in Dark Brown smudged under the eyes for some definition. To finish the eyes I used the Clinique High Definition Lashes in Black.
